Address Technical Barriers That Limit Visibility

Technical glitches such as outdated NAP info or inconsistent data can cause your profile to stall. I once audited a business and found discrepancies in their profile data, which I fixed, resulting in restored visibility. Regularly perform technical audits and update all data points. To learn more about troubleshooting, visit technical fix guides. Eliminating these issues ensures your profile isn’t silently penalized or hidden due to technical faults. Keep your listings clean, consistent, and compliant with current standards.

Keep Your Strategy Moving with Proven Tools

Staying ahead in local SEO requires more than just initial optimization; it demands ongoing maintenance, data tracking, and strategic adjustments. I rely on a set of specialized tools that empower me to monitor, analyze, and optimize maps ranking effectively. One of my top picks is BrightLocal, which is invaluable for tracking local search rankings, managing reviews seamlessly, and auditing citation consistency in real-time. Its comprehensive dashboards give me immediate insights into how my optimizations are performing, allowing quick pivots when needed.

For technical audits and fixing profile issues, I use Seobility. This platform probes deep into website and local profile health, catching dangling citations, inconsistent NAP data, and technical glitches that can silently tarnish your local visibility. Its crawl reports help me identify and prioritize fixes, ensuring my profiles stay compliant with the latest signals—crucial in the ever-evolving 2026 landscape.

In terms of data management and automation, Zapier has become an indispensable tool. I set up custom workflows that automatically update and verify information across different directories when I receive new client data, reducing manual effort and minimizing errors. This level of automation ensures my profiles remain fresh and authoritative, which is vital for long-term success.
